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a foldable side rail having an enhanced safety upon using and storing, having an elevatable construction in which a pair of upper lateral members arranged in a lateral direction and a plurality of prop members arranged between common lower lateral members are rotatably jointed to construct a parallel linking mechanism so that the elevation is realized by an inter-connected mechanism in an inter connected manner.SOLUTION: In the present invention, an inter-connected arm 7 and an inter-connected link 8 constructing an inter-connected mechanism are rotatably jointed with a long hole 9 at the side of the inter-connected arm and an axis member 10 at the side of the inter-connected link engaged on the long hole 9 in a manner that the axis member 10 may slide in its longitudinal direction. The long hole is formed on a tip of the inter-connected arm in a manner that the long hole faces in a longitudinal direction in a standing condition of the prop members 2f.

本発明は、ストレッチャーやベッド等の仰臥台に取り付けて使用する折り畳み式サイドレールに関する。   The present invention relates to a foldable side rail used by being attached to a supine table such as a stretcher or a bed.

上部横桟部材と下部横桟部材間に複数の支柱部材を平行リンク機構を構成するように回動可能に連結し、前記支柱部材を起立させて上部横桟部材を高い位置に支持する使用状態と、支柱部材を倒して上部横桟部材を低い位置に支持する格納状態とすることができ、支柱部材を起立させた状態で保持する保持機構を設けた構成の折り畳み式サイドレールがストレッチャーやベッド等に広く使用されている。   A use state in which a plurality of support members are rotatably connected to form a parallel link mechanism between the upper cross member and the lower cross member, and the support member is raised to support the upper cross member in a high position. The folding side rail with a holding mechanism that holds the column member in an upright state can be used as a stretcher or the like. Widely used for beds.

このような構成の折り畳み式サイドレールは、例えば特許文献1や特許文献2の他、多数提案されている。   Many foldable side rails having such a configuration have been proposed in addition to Patent Document 1 and Patent Document 2, for example.

一方、ストレッチャーやベッド等では、床上の患者等と外部の機器等との間にチューブやケーブル等を接続することがあり、サイドレールは、使用状態においても、チューブやケーブル等を高い位置を経ずに通せることが望まれる。これに対して、従来ではサイドレールを左右一対に構成して、これらの間にケーブル等を通すようにしたり、サイドレールの本体自体に上部から凹溝を形成して、この凹溝にケーブル等を通すようにしたものがある。   On the other hand, in stretchers, beds, etc., tubes and cables may be connected between patients on the floor and external equipment, etc. It is hoped that you can pass through it. In contrast, conventionally, a pair of left and right side rails are configured so that cables or the like are passed between them, or a concave groove is formed in the main body of the side rail from above, and a cable or the like is formed in the concave groove. There are things that let you pass.

また特許文献3に記載された救急用やICU用のベッドでは、左右方向に配置した一対の上部横桟部材と下部横桟部材間に、夫々の上部横桟部材毎に4本の支柱部材を平行リンク機構を構成するように回動可能に連結し、各上部横桟部材に連結した隣接側の夫々2本の支柱部材には連動アームを突設すると共に、これらの連動アームの先端を、平行リンク機構を構成するように連動リンクで回動可能に連結した構成の連動機構により、左右一対の上部横桟部材を連動して昇降可能とした折り畳み式サイドレールが使用されている。   Further, in the emergency or ICU bed described in Patent Document 3, four strut members are provided for each upper horizontal beam member between a pair of upper and lower horizontal beam members arranged in the left-right direction. The two linked strut members on the adjacent side connected to each upper side rail member are pivotally connected so as to constitute a parallel link mechanism, and projecting interlocking arms, and the tip ends of these interlocking arms, A foldable side rail is used in which a pair of left and right upper horizontal rail members can be moved up and down by an interlocking mechanism configured to be pivotally connected by an interlocking link so as to constitute a parallel link mechanism.

特許第3029026号公報Japanese Patent No. 3029026 特許第5137116号公報Japanese Patent No. 5137116 意匠登録第1203652号公報Design Registration No. 1203652

ここで、一対のユニットを左右に配置する構成のサイドレールでは、ボードとの間の隙間と、ユニット間の隙間が安全上の重要なファクターであり、これらの隙間は、例えばJIS規格(JIS T 9254)では、直径12cmの円柱形の物を、50Nの力で差し込んだ場合にも円柱形が入り込まないか、または23.5cm以上であることが規定されている。   Here, in the side rail having a configuration in which a pair of units are arranged on the left and right, the gap between the board and the gap between the units are important factors for safety. These gaps are, for example, JIS standards (JIS T 9254) stipulates that when a cylindrical object having a diameter of 12 cm is inserted with a force of 50 N, the cylindrical object does not enter or is 23.5 cm or more.

従って、平行リンク機構を構成するように下部横桟部材上に複数の支柱部材により支持された左右の上部横桟部材を、平行リンク機構を構成する連動機構により連動させて昇降可能とした折り畳み式サイドレールでは、前記連動機構は、使用状態における上部横桟部材間の間隔が設定値よりも広がらないような構成とする必要がある。   Therefore, the foldable type that the left and right upper horizontal beam members supported by the plurality of support members on the lower horizontal beam member so as to configure the parallel link mechanism can be moved up and down by being interlocked by the interlocking mechanism that configures the parallel link mechanism. In the side rail, the interlocking mechanism needs to be configured such that the interval between the upper crosspiece members in the used state does not become wider than the set value.

また、このような折り畳み式サイドレールでは、連動機構を構成する部材の製造上の誤差により、回動支点の位置が平行四辺形からずれる場合があり、この場合には、格納状態において、本来は当接するべき部材間、例えば後述する図8に示すように、支柱部材の上端に設けた当接部材と、この当接部材が当接する隣接の支柱部材との間に隙間Sを生じてしまう場合があり、この隙間は、例えば上部横桟部材に腰掛ける等のように下方への力を加えた場合には無くなるため、このような力によって、操作者等の指を挟んでしまうというような危険性も生じる。   Further, in such a foldable side rail, the position of the rotation fulcrum may deviate from the parallelogram due to the manufacturing error of the members constituting the interlocking mechanism. When a gap S is generated between the members to be contacted, for example, as shown in FIG. 8 described later, between the contact member provided at the upper end of the support member and the adjacent support member to which the contact member contacts. This gap disappears when a downward force is applied, for example, when sitting on the upper crosspiece member, etc., so that such a force may cause the operator's fingers to be pinched. Sex also occurs.

従って、連動機構を有する折り畳み式サイドレールでは、連動機構によって、本来、当接するべき部材間には隙間を生じないようにする必要がある。
本発明は、このような課題を解決することを目的とするものである。
Therefore, in a foldable side rail having an interlocking mechanism, it is necessary to prevent a gap from being generated between members that should be in contact with each other by the interlocking mechanism.
The present invention aims to solve such problems.

上述した課題を解決するために、本発明では、左右方向に配置した一対の上部横桟部材と、共通の下部横桟部材間に複数の支柱部材を平行リンク機構を構成するように回動可能に連結し、夫々の上部横桟部材に連結した隣接側の少なくとも夫々1本の支柱部材に連動アームを突設すると共に、これらの連動アームの先端を平行リンク機構を構成するように連動リンクで回動可能に連結し、前記一対の上部横桟部材の一方側に対応して、支柱部材を起立させた状態で保持する保持機構を設けた構成の折り畳み式サイドレールにおいて、連動アームの先端と連動リンクとは、連動アーム側の長穴と、この長穴に、その長手方向にのみ移動可能に係合させた連動リンク側の軸部材とにより回動可能に連結する構成とし、前記長穴は、支柱部材が起立状態において縦方向に向き、支柱部材が倒れた状態において横方向に向くように連動アームの先端に形成した折り畳み式サイドレールを提案する。   In order to solve the above-described problems, in the present invention, a plurality of support members can be rotated so as to constitute a parallel link mechanism between a pair of upper horizontal members arranged in the left-right direction and a common lower horizontal member. Are connected to each upper horizontal crosspiece member, and at least one post member on the adjacent side is connected to each upper side crosspiece member, and the end of these interlocking arms is connected with an interlocking link so as to constitute a parallel link mechanism. In a foldable side rail having a holding mechanism that is rotatably connected and corresponds to one side of the pair of upper crosspiece members and holds the column member in an upright state, The interlocking link is configured to be rotatably connected by a long hole on the interlocking arm side and a shaft member on the interlocking link side engaged with the long hole so as to be movable only in the longitudinal direction. The column member stands up Oriented in the longitudinal direction in the state, we propose a foldable side rail formed on the distal end of the interlocking arm so as to face in the lateral direction in a state where the strut member has fallen.

また本発明では、前記構成において、連動アームを突設する支柱部材は、各上部横桟部材に連結した隣接側の夫々少なくとも1本とした折り畳み式サイドレールを提案する。   According to the present invention, there is proposed a foldable side rail in which, in the above-described configuration, at least one column member for projecting the interlocking arm is provided on each of the adjacent sides connected to each upper crosspiece member.

長穴を設けた連動アームは、連動リンクに設けた軸部材に対して、長穴の長手方向に沿って移動可能である。しかしながら、長穴は、支柱部材が起立状態においては縦方向に向いているため、この状態では連動アームは連動リンクの軸部材に対して横方向には移動できない。このように長穴を形成した連動アームを設けた支柱部材は横方向に移動できない起立状態で維持されるため、保持機構を設けていない上部横桟部材の支柱部材は、保持機構を設けている上部横桟部材の支柱部材に対して所定位置関係が維持される。   The interlocking arm provided with the elongated hole is movable along the longitudinal direction of the elongated hole with respect to the shaft member provided in the interlocking link. However, since the elongated hole is oriented in the vertical direction when the column member is standing, the interlocking arm cannot move laterally with respect to the shaft member of the interlocking link in this state. Since the column member provided with the interlocking arm in which the long hole is formed in this way is maintained in an upright state where it cannot move in the lateral direction, the column member of the upper horizontal beam member not provided with the holding mechanism is provided with the holding mechanism. A predetermined positional relationship is maintained with respect to the support member of the upper horizontal cross member.

従って、一対の上部横桟部材の端部間の間隔が所定間隔に維持され、安全性が阻害されない。   Accordingly, the distance between the ends of the pair of upper crosspiece members is maintained at a predetermined distance, and safety is not hindered.

一方側の上部横桟部材に設けた保持機構による保持を解除すると、この上部横桟部材に連結した支柱部材と共に、保持機構を設けていない上部横桟部材の支柱部材も連動機構により連動して回動下降が可能となる。   When the holding mechanism provided on the upper horizontal beam member on one side is released, the column member connected to the upper horizontal beam member and the column member of the upper horizontal beam member not provided with the holding mechanism are also interlocked by the interlocking mechanism. The rotation can be lowered.

このように支柱部材が回動下降して倒れた状態となると、連動アームに形成された長穴は横方向に向くようになるため、連動アームの長穴の個所は、連動リンクの軸部材に対して横方向に移動可能となる。即ち、横方向の遊びが生じる。   In this way, when the strut member is pivoted down and falls down, the slot formed in the interlocking arm will turn in the horizontal direction, so the location of the slot in the interlocking arm will be on the shaft member of the interlocking link. On the other hand, it can move in the horizontal direction. That is, lateral play occurs.

このため連動機構を構成する部材、即ち、連動アームや連動リンクの製造上の誤差により、それらの回動支点の位置が平行四辺形からずれた場合でも、長穴が形成された連動アームを有する支柱部材が前記遊びにより移動可能となって、平行四辺形からのずれを解消するように作用する。   For this reason, it has the interlocking arm in which the long hole was formed even if the position of those rotation fulcrum shifts from the parallelogram due to the manufacturing error of the interlocking arm and the interlocking link. The column member is movable by the play and acts to eliminate the deviation from the parallelogram.

このため、本来当接するべき部材間、例えば支柱部材の上端に設けた当接部材と、この当接部材が当接する隣接の支柱部材との間に隙間を生じてしまうことを防ぐことができる。したがって隙間のために操作者等の指を挟んでしまうというような危険性が生じない。   For this reason, it can prevent that a clearance gap produces between the members which should be contact | abutted originally, for example, the contact member provided in the upper end of the support | pillar member, and the adjacent support | pillar member which this contact member contacts. Therefore, there is no danger of the operator's finger being caught due to the gap.
